Transaction 0373c8ba970694916ecfb456ebc2c22a52fc77caed7bb1463d2c4cf6b8e4f3d5
1 Input
1 Output
-
0373c8ba970694916ecfb456ebc2c22a52fc77caed7bb1463d2c4cf6b8e4f3d5:0
- value
- 593638
- script pubkey
- OP_0 OP_PUSHBYTES_20 2b660dc7eaabc90ae84fc8374e3b62f4065b8fa5
- address
- bc1q9dnqm3l240ys46z0eqm5uwmz7sr9hra999xyut